I've seen "lamp aquariums" that were made from glass 5 gallon water cooler-type jugs, but nothing as small as the one Brooke showed. These "lamps" had an airline running through the top, the light fixture itself was totally contained and detachable from the "aquarium" part, it basically just clamped on.

This was years ago and I thought it looked pretty cool back then. Looking back on it now, it still looks cool but I can't help but see what a PITA it must be to take care of and deal with any problems, lol.
